You'll shape how developers and agents experience Abba Baba — from the registration flow to the marketplace discovery UI to the developer dashboard. This is a unique challenge: designing for humans who build agents, and for agents themselves. You'll bring UX rigor to a product space where the rules are still being written.

Responsibilities

  • Design user flows and interaction patterns for the Abba Baba developer experience
  • Conduct usability research with agent developers to validate design decisions
  • Create prototypes and run experiments to test design hypotheses
  • Define and maintain a design system that scales across platform surfaces
  • Collaborate with engineering on implementation fidelity and edge case handling
  • Document design rationale and decision history for future reference
